Abstract

This study aims to determine the influence of leadership style and work stress on employee performance at the Population and Civil Registration Office of Makassar City. This is a quantitative research study. The sample consists of all 54 employees at the Population and Civil Registration Office, selected using a saturated sampling technique. The type of data used is quantitative data obtained from questionnaires distributed based on the research problem. Data collection techniques include observation, documentation, and questionnaire distribution.. Based on statistical analysis using SPSS version 26, the results showed that leadership style has a positive and significant effect on employee performance, with a t-count value of 2.515 > 2,008 and a significance value of 0.015 < 0.05. Work stress also has a positive and significant effect on employee performance, with a t-count value of 2.422 > 2,008 and a significance value of 0.019 < 0.05. Therefore, leadership style and work stress should be continuously improved and effectively managed, as both have a significant impact on enhancing employee performance.

Abstract

This literature review aims to develop hypotheses for future research regarding the factors that influence employee performance in the public sector. The article, titled "Determination of Employee Performance: Analysis of Leadership, Competence, and Discipline through Employee Retention," adopts a comparative analysis approach by reviewing 53 relevant studies published within the last eight years. The data sources include reputable academic databases such as Scopus, Web of Science, Elsevier, Springer, SAGE, Emerald, DOAJ, EBSCO, and SINTA 2–5 journals. The findings of the literature review reveal that: (1) Leadership, competence, and discipline significantly influence employee retention; (2) These three variables also have a direct impact on employee performance; and (3) Employee retention mediates the relationship between leadership, competence, and discipline with employee performance. The study The study provides a conceptual framework that highlights the importance of human resource management strategies that integrate these key variables to enhance employee performance in public organizations

Abstract

Entrepreneurship among students is an important aspect in encouraging innovation and economic development. Recognizing the critical role of university support in shaping students' entrepreneurial journeys, this research explores the complex dynamics between such university support, self-efficacy, and entrepreneurial intentions. In an era where startups contribute significantly to the economy, understanding this relationship is a must for educational institutions. The main objective is to analyze the impact of university support on students' entrepreneurial intentions through the mediating influence of self-efficacy. A comprehensive survey-based methodology will be used to collect data from a diverse sample of private university students in DKI Jakarta. The survey includes validated scales to measure university support, self-efficacy, and entrepreneurial intentions. The statistical technique is structural equation modeling. Preliminary findings reveal significant correlations between university support, self-efficacy, and entrepreneurial intentions. Mediation analysis reveals that university support influences students' entrepreneurial intentions through self-efficacy. This research contributes valuable insights to entrepreneurship education by highlighting the mediating role of self-efficacy in the relationship between university support and entrepreneurial intentions. The results of this research have implications for universities that want to optimize their support systems to foster students with an entrepreneurial spirit, which ultimately encourages innovation.

Abstract

The purpose of this research is to investigate the effect of organizational culture (OC) and human resource development practice (HR) on knowledge assets (KA) and knowledge transfer performance (KT). This type of research is survey research that takes samples from a population and uses a questionnaire as a primary data collection tool. The population in this study were all staff in the PT PLN (Persero) UIW Sulselrabar of 197 people. The sampling technique in this study used a saturated sample. The results of the study show that OC and HR have a significant impact on KA. KA has a significant impact on KT, while OC and HR are not significant on KT. Finally, the perceived benefits of OC and HR can create positive attitudes about KA.

Abstract

The problem of the development of micro, small and medium enterprises (MSMEs) is the most dominant research topic, especially in developing countries that rely on these sectors in their economy. The purpose of this study was to analyze the effect of entrepreneurial orientation on the performance of MSMEs through the mediation of business independence variables. This type of research is field research and literature which aims to answer the formulation of the research problem. The research location is in Makassar City, South Sulawesi. The population in this study is 16.492 MSMEs. The number of samples in this study was determined by the Slovin formula, so the sample size is 100 SMEs. The sampling method is probability sampling with simple random sampling technique, namely proportional random sampling for each business sector. Data analysis techniques use structural equation model analysis. The results showed that the entrepreneurial orientation variable had a significant effect on the performance of MSMEs, both directly and through the business independence variable. Based on the findings of this study, further research is needed regarding the performance of SMEs to explore other variables.

Abstract

The purpose of this study was to examine the impact of gacha addiction and good price on the intention topurchase in-app items, with mobile game loyalty as a mediating variable. The research employed a quantitativeapproach using Partial Least Squares-Structural Equation Modeling (PLS-SEM) to analyze survey datacollected from 208 Genshin Impact players in Indonesia through random sampling and online questionnaires.The results indicate that gacha addiction significantly influences the intention to purchase in-app items, whilegood price has a moderate effect. Additionally, mobile game loyalty serves as a partial mediator in therelationship between gacha addiction and purchase intention.

Abstract

The telecommunications industry is one of the most competitive industries with high penetration of digital technology, faster availability of data services, and innovations in telecommunications. The purpose of the present study is to empirically test a model that illustrates how customer relationship marketing (CRM) and customer bonding (CBD) affect customer loyalty (CLA) with customer satisfaction (CSA) as a mediating variable in the telecommunication company. A survey of the telecommunication customers was conducted with responses from 230 samples by maximizing the Partial-Least-Square Structural-Equation Modeling (PLS-SEM). The research results show that CRM and CBD are inferred to impact CLA and mediate CSA significantly. Compared to CRM, CBD has emerged as the most influential determinant of the proposed model. Marketing managers can adopt relevant business strategies and promote customer relationship marketing and customer bonding to achieve customer loyalty.

Abstract

Penelitian ini bertujuan untuk menganalisis pengaruh digitalisasi pelayanan dan kompetensi pegawai terhadap efektivitas pemungutan pajak daerah pada Badan Pendapatan Daerah Kabupaten Enrekang. Penelitian menggunakan pendekatan kuantitatif dengan jenis penelitian asosiatif. Populasi penelitian mencakup seluruh pegawai yang terlibat langsung dalam pelayanan dan pemungutan pajak daerah, dengan teknik total sampling sehingga diperoleh 50 responden. Data dikumpulkan melalui kuesioner menggunakan skala Likert dan dianalisis menggunakan regresi linear berganda dengan bantuan SPSS versi 27, melalui tahapan uji validitas, reliabilitas, uji asumsi klasik, serta pengujian hipotesis. Hasil penelitian menunjukkan bahwa digitalisasi pelayanan berpengaruh positif dan signifikan terhadap efektivitas pemungutan pajak daerah dengan nilai signifikansi 0,006 (<0,05). Kompetensi pegawai juga memiliki pengaruh positif dan signifikan dengan nilai signifikansi 0,000 (<0,05), serta menjadi variabel yang lebih dominan. Secara simultan, kedua variabel berpengaruh signifikan terhadap efektivitas pemungutan pajak daerah dengan nilai signifikansi 0,000 (<0,05) dan koefisien determinasi sebesar 57,2%. Hal ini menunjukkan bahwa efektivitas pemungutan pajak tidak hanya ditentukan oleh teknologi, tetapi juga oleh kualitas sumber daya manusia. Temuan ini mengindikasikan bahwa peningkatan digitalisasi pelayanan harus diiringi dengan penguatan kompetensi pegawai agar dapat mencapai hasil yang optimal. Meskipun demikian, kendala seperti keterbatasan infrastruktur dan rendahnya literasi digital masyarakat masih menjadi tantangan dalam implementasi. Oleh karena itu, diperlukan strategi terintegrasi yang mencakup pengembangan sistem digital, peningkatan kapasitas pegawai, serta edukasi masyarakat guna meningkatkan efektivitas pemungutan pajak daerah secara berkelanjutan
